Where can I get an animation?

Since most dog owners have pure breeds or immediate crossed pets, it should just be modest to get a chicken for your canine, but instead of a slaughter bring home a living species as a specimen.

Can you just stop talking?

Now you need to be in an environment where there is no distraction, no organism should be in your dog's field of view. Put the specimen some distance away, let your dog see it, let him lose interest in the alien. Now this is where bonding takes place, for you're to go from total calm to stampede.

Begin stroking the dog, petting him, rubbing him, and gblaow, bolt. You're to shock yourself, shock your surrounding and shock your dog. As you're stroking the young man just run straight at the direction of the animation, if your dog loves you and is willing to protect, he will give that specimen the chase of its life. But if it were to be a mother hen or a mother goat, it will go from vulnerable to untouchable.

Naturally aggressive dogs like Rotts will RIP that unfortunate animal to pieces, this you should avoid so that he doesn't taste blood or flesh, cause in your next exercise, he will chase the specimen for food not as a protector.

In the case of the specimen being an human, the distance as to be wide, the human has to be bold and has to be prepared in case of lapses or error. You should have an opening, a room or an enclosure where the person can run into and shut himself to prevent a confrontation. You can use a person your dog doesn't like, don't use a person your dog likes, is fond of or very familiar with, in this case, he will this as play time not rage time.

Start the stroking process, involve the dog, now suddenly bolt into an half run, point at the human and yell attack(or your word of choice), the human should take the cue and run. Why? Dogs who learnt the attack using animals are less likely to pursue humans at their first command, that is, if you trained them using animals and they have mastered the command, they might not respond to your command if you point at a human, instead they look for an unlucky animal to chase. So at the animal stage, it ain't necessary to use a command, but at human stage you Must use the command and a pointed finger at the direction.


After your dog has chased either the aforementioned animal or latter human. Pet him alot, treats aren't necessary cause predatory is something they love, plus praise him with "Good boy" or something else. Try this 3 times or lesser a day, so he knows the serious nature and doesn't see it as a play which can become boring.
